Series Analysis:
Snoopy in Space represents a sophisticated evolution of Charles M. Schulz’s iconic property. By aligning the Peanuts brand with NASA, the series moved beyond neighborhood antics to provide a grounded yet whimsical look at space exploration. Its legacy is defined by its ability to modernize classic characters for the Apple TV+ era without sacrificing their core innocence. The show effectively bridged the gap between 1960s nostalgia and modern STEM initiatives, securing a new generation of fans. By maintaining a high standard of animation, it solidified the beagle’s place as a global ambassador for curiosity. Although this specific journey has reached its finale, the stars remain reachable.
